Swami answers questions by Smt. Priyanka

1. Why did Lalita always support Radha's love to Krishna?

[Smt. Priyanka asked: Padanamaskaram Swami, Among the Gopikas, why did Lalita always support Radha's love to Krishna and chose to keep quiet about her love for Krishna? At Your divine lotus feet, Priyanka]

Swami replied: The psychologies of devotees are not important because they are souls only. The mind of a soul is always working in unpredictable ways (Vicitrarūpāḥ khalu citta vṛttayaḥ). Perhaps Lalita found the love of Radha to be more pure and intensive than her love.

2. Did the Gopikas jump into the fire due to an excess of emotion?

[Smt. Priyanka asked: Padanamaskaram Swami, Gopikas arrived at the conclusion that whatever pleases God is punyam and whatever displeases God is paapam. Therefore, they must have known that ending their life doesn't please God. Hence, did they jump into the fire only due to excess emotion?]

Swami replied: Yes. They have jumped due to excess of emotion. In fact, Krishna told them many a time that suicide is a very serious sin. But, their love to Krishna made them blind at that moment.

4. Was Lord Krishna displeased when His wives jumped in to the fire?

[Lord Krishna's 8 wives also jumped into the fire at the end. Is it a sin in their case as well? Was Lord Krishna displeased?]

Swami replied: Except Satyabhama, who went to forest for doing penance, all other wives jumped in to fire, which was a serious sin and accordingly they underwent punishments. Punishment is only for the reformation of the soul so that repetition of the sin is prevented. Due to the excess of their emotion, they forgot that Krishna is God who left His gross body without a trace of any pain just like a person changing the dress.

5. Is it sinful for the wife to end her life by sitting on her husband’s funeral pyre?

[A lot of Kshatriya women in India used to volunteer to sit on their husband's funeral pyre to protect their honor, etc. Was it sinful for those wives to end their lives as well? At Your divine lotus feet, Priyanka]

Swami replied: Certainly, it is very serious sin because God has given this human life to proceed with spiritual efforts and propagation of His true spiritual knowledge in this world. Suicide is against the will of God.

6. Can You please explain the meaning of the three Vedic accents?

[Smt. Priyanka asked: Padanamaskaram Swami, In the bhajan 'Shri Datta Brahma Gayatri', there is a verse - "sṛṣṭi kramavada puruṣasūktaṃ trisvarabaddhaṃ pāvanārtham"

In the translation it said that sages recite with the three holy Vedic accents, the Vedic Purusha Suktam, which reveals the process of creation. Can You please explain what the three Vedic accents mean? At Your divine lotus feet, Priyanka]

Swami replied: The Vedic accents are just musical modes to increase the pleasantness in the recitation. Udatta is downward sound. Anudatta means upward sound. Svarita means the upwards long stretched sound.
